Instant Pot Ribs

These tender ribs start in a pressure cooker. A dry rub is made with salt, brown sugar, black p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, chili powder and crushed red pepper. The rack of ribs is rubbed with the spice mixture. Then a can of Coke and liquid smoke are added to a pressure cooker. Next the ribs are added and cooked on high pressure, then removed from the pot and brushed with barbecue sauce before placing on a warm grill. The ribs are grilled until the sauce browns and becomes sticky.
Course Entree
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 35 minutes
Servings 4 people

Ingredients

  • 2 tbsp kosher salt
  • 2 tbsp brown sugar
  • 1 tsp black pepper
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• 1 tsp onion powder
  • 1 tsp chili powder
  • 1 tsp crushed red pepper
  • 1 rack baby back ribs
  • 12 oz can coke
  • ¼ tsp liquid smoke
  • 1 cup barbecue sauce

Instructions

  1. Combine first 7 ingredients and mix together to make a rub. Set aside.
  2. Remove the membrane from the back of the ribs by loosening one end with a knife and grabbing with a paper towel and pulling off.
  3. Apply rub to both sides of ribs and place metal ring inside of pressure cooker.
  4. Pour coke and liquid smoke into center of pot. Add ribs to instant pot.
  5. Pressure cook on manual HIGH for 30 minutes and allow pressure to release naturally. (will take about 15 minutes to come to pressure.)

Baking:

  1. Preheat oven to 400 F.
  2. Transfer ribs to broiler pan and brush with barbecue sauce.
  3. Bake 10-15 minutes or so, ensure ribs don’t burn.

Grilling:

  1. Warm the grill to medium-high heat.
  2. Grill for 3-4 minutes until some of the sauce is browned and sticky.
